Author (up) Gardner, E.L.; Engel, D.R.
Title Imitational and social facilitatory aspects of observational learning in the laboratory rat Type Journal Article
Year 1971 Publication Psychonomic Science Abbreviated Journal Psychon. Sci.
Volume 25 Issue 1 Pages 5-6
Keywords
Abstract Rats acquired a food-motivated leverpressing response by “observational learning” or by trial-and-error learning under conditions of social facilitation or isolation. Both the observational learning and social facilitation Ss learned faster than did the isolated trial-and-error Ss. There was no difference in speed of learning between the observational learning and social facilitation groups. It is suggested that some previous studies purporting to demonstrate observational learning may have demonstrated socially facilitated trial-and-error learning instead.
